.GamesSection_container__A0ViO{display:flex;flex-direction:column;gap:64px}.GamesSection_listAndAction__k_1Xw{display:flex;flex-direction:column;gap:32px;padding:16px;background-color:var(--color-foreground);container-type:inline-size}@container (width < 768px){.GamesSection_listAndAction__k_1Xw{gap:16px;padding:12px}}.HeadingSvg_svgContainer__DgIWk{width:100%;height:96px;position:relative}@container (width < 768px){.HeadingSvg_svgContainer__DgIWk{height:64px}}.HeadingSvg_base__r8ffP{position:absolute;inset:0;display:flex;justify-content:center}.HeadingSvg_base__r8ffP svg{display:block;fill:#fff;height:100%}.HeadingSvg_overlay__AFV6M{position:absolute;inset:0}.HeadingSvg_overlay__AFV6M .HeadingSvg_cyan__vE6d8{mix-blend-mode:screen;display:flex;justify-content:center;position:absolute;inset:0;width:100%;height:100%;transform:translateX(-3px)}.HeadingSvg_overlay__AFV6M .HeadingSvg_cyan__vE6d8 svg{height:100%;fill:aqua;fill-opacity:.5}.HeadingSvg_overlay__AFV6M .HeadingSvg_red__1aQWi{mix-blend-mode:screen;position:absolute;inset:0;display:flex;justify-content:center;width:100%;height:100%;transform:translateX(3px)}.HeadingSvg_overlay__AFV6M .HeadingSvg_red__1aQWi svg{height:100%;fill:red;fill-opacity:.5}.Heading_container___H6y6{font-size:32px;font-weight:700;line-height:1}.Card_container__K5xQc{display:flex;flex-direction:column;gap:8px;height:100%;transition:.1s ease-in-out}@container (width < 768px){.Card_container__K5xQc{gap:4px}}.Card_image__gamjZ{width:100%;aspect-ratio:16/9;background-color:var(--color-brand);object-fit:cover;transition:.1s ease-in-out}.Card_image__gamjZ img{width:100%;height:100%;object-fit:cover}.Card_container__K5xQc:hover .Card_image__gamjZ{opacity:.75}.Card_texts__ZllwM{display:flex;flex-direction:column;gap:8px;transition:.1s ease-in-out}@container (width < 768px){.Card_texts__ZllwM{gap:4px}}.Card_container__K5xQc:hover .Card_texts__ZllwM{color:var(--color-brand)}.Card_date__gu4HV{font-size:12px;font-weight:600}@container (width < 768px){.Card_date__gu4HV{font-size:10px}}.Card_title__DEnyR{font-size:16px;font-weight:600}@container (width < 768px){.Card_title__DEnyR{font-size:14px}}.Card_description__jLdJH{font-size:14px;font-weight:400}@container (width < 768px){.Card_description__jLdJH{font-size:12px}}.GameList_container__y1P3C{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:16px;gap:16px;container-type:inline-size}@container (max-width: 768px){.GameList_container__y1P3C{gr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(1,1fr);gap:12px}}.Button_container__6_DOI{display:flex;gap:8px;align-items:center;justify-content:center;padding:8px;color:var(--color-foreground);font-size:16px;border:4px solid var(--color-brand);position:relative}.Button_container__6_DOI[data-disabled=true]{background-color:gray}.Button_container__6_DOI:not([data-disabled=true]){position:relative;background-color:var(--color-brand);transition:.1s ease-in-out}.Button_container__6_DOI:not([data-disabled=true]):hover{background-color:var(--color-foreground);color:var(--color-brand)}.Button_container__6_DOI:not([data-disabled=true]):before{content:"";display:block;position:absolute;top:0;left:0;width:50%;height:100%;background-color:aqua;z-index:-1;transform:translateX(0);transition:.1s ease-in-out;opacity:.5}.Button_container__6_DOI:not([data-disabled=true]):hover:before{transform:translateX(-4px)}.Button_container__6_DOI:not([data-disabled=true]):after{content:"";display:block;position:absolute;top:0;right:0;width:50%;height:100%;background-color:red;z-index:-1;transform:translateX(0);transition:.1s ease-in-out;opacity:.5}.Button_container__6_DOI:not([data-disabled=true]):hover:after{transform:translateX(4px)}.Hero_container__qXsff{container-type:inline-size}.Hero_background__r9oUT{display:block;width:100%;height:100%}.Hero_heroImage__yrehp{width:100%;height:100%;object-fit:cover}.Hero_heroImage__yrehp[data-size=wide]{aspect-ratio:16/5}.Hero_heroImage__yrehp[data-size=square]{display:none;aspect-ratio:1/1}@container (width < 768px){.Hero_heroImage__yrehp[data-size=wide]{display:none}.Hero_heroImage__yrehp[data-size=square]{display:block}}.Hero_description__4W8R_{padding:1rem;background-color:var(--color-foreground);border-bottom:1px solid var(--color-border);font-weight:500;text-align:center}.Hero_link__GUGoM:hover .Hero_description__4W8R_{text-decoration:underline}.Hero_link__GUGoM:hover .Hero_heroImage__yrehp{filter:saturate(1.2)}.PickupSection_container__LSffN{display:flex;flex-direction:column;gap:64px}.PickupList_container__nxVnt{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:16px;gap:16px;padding:16px;background-color:var(--color-foreground)}@container (width < 768px){.PickupList_container__nxVnt{grid-template-columns:repeat(2,1fr);grid-template-rows:repeat(1,1fr);gap:12px;padding:12px}}.page_page__wGsx6{display:flex;flex-direction:column}.page_sectionRowWrap__imrLC{position:relative;padding-inline:16px;-webkit-padding-before:64px;padding-block-start:64px;-webkit-padding-after:128px;padding-block-end:128px}.page_sectionRowWrap__imrLC:after{content:"";display:block;position:absolute;inset:0;width:100%;height:100%;background:var(--color-brand);z-index:-1}.page_sectionRowContainer__ZYRlm{display:grid;grid-gap:16px;gap:16px;grid-template-columns:1fr 1fr}@media(max-width:767px){.page_sectionRowContainer__ZYRlm{grid-template-columns:1fr}}.page_pickupSection__PFJMl{-webkit-padding-before:64px;padding-block-start:64px;-webkit-padding-after:128px;padding-block-end:128px;padding-inline:16px;container-type:inline-size;position:relative;z-index:-1}.HistoryList_container__12L8P{display:flex;flex-direction:column;gap:32px;width:100%}.HistoryList_headingContainer__qdgyi{align-items:center;padding-block:16px;padding-inline:16px}.HistoryList_listWithActionContainer__qH08m{display:flex;flex-direction:column;gap:16px;background-color:#fff;border:1px solid var(--color-border);box-shadow:0 0 24px rgba(0,0,0,.1);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.HistoryList_listContainer__JGCKE{display:flex;flex-direction:column;gap:20px;width:100%;padding-block:16px;padding-inline:16px}.HistoryList_actionContainer__8Nv4k{display:flex;flex-direction:row;gap:16px}.HistoryList_listItem__2CHWt{display:grid;grid-gap:8px;gap:8px;grid-template-columns:96px 1fr}.HistoryList_contents__zn5ZR{display:flex;flex-direction:column;gap:16px}.HistoryItem_container__VX4tI{display:grid;grid-template-columns:96px 1fr;grid-gap:16px;gap:16px;width:100%}@container (width < 768px){.HistoryItem_container__VX4tI{grid-template-columns:1fr;gap:8px}}.HistoryItem_category__95jhf{--color-label-bg:#454545;display:grid;width:100%;place-items:center;background-color:var(--color-label-bg);padding-block:4px;padding-inline:8px;font-weight:700;color:#fff}@container (width < 768px){.HistoryItem_category__95jhf{width:-moz-fit-content;width:fit-content}}.HistoryItem_category__95jhf[data-category=adult]{--color-label-bg:#e6002d}.HistoryItem_category__95jhf[data-category=nonadult]{--color-label-bg:#e98f09}.HistoryItem_category__95jhf[data-category=blog]{--color-label-bg:#43aa8b}.HistoryItem_category__95jhf[data-category=youtube]{--color-label-bg:red}.HistoryItem_category__95jhf[data-category=mail]{--color-label-bg:#4364aa}.HistoryItem_category__95jhf[data-category=other]{--color-label-bg:#999}.HistoryItem_category__95jhf[data-category=ROOMGIRL]{--color-label-bg:#43aa8b}.HistoryItem_category__95jhf[data-category=ROOMGIRL_PARADISE]{--color-label-bg:#7a1a2a}.HistoryItem_category__95jhf span{font-size:12px}.HistoryItem_link__bGN5i{width:-moz-fit-content;width:fit-content}.HistoryItem_linkText__Ne3x3{font-size:16px;color:var(--color-text);text-decoration:none}.HistoryItem_linkText__Ne3x3:hover{text-decoration:underline}.Inner_container__fH1Sn{width:100%;max-width:1280px;margin-inline:auto;container-type:inline-size}.ParallaxSection_container__3YznP{position:relative;padding-block:64px;padding-inline:16px;overflow:hidden}.ParallaxSection_container__3YznP[data-is-skewed=true]{-webkit-clip-path:polygon(0 4vw,100% 0,100% calc(100% - 4vw),0 100%);clip-path:polygon(0 4vw,100% 0,100% calc(100% - 4vw),0 100%);margin-block:-4vw;padding-block:128px;z-index:1}.ParallaxSection_container__3YznP[data-expand=before]{-webkit-padding-before:128px;padding-block-start:128px}.ParallaxSection_container__3YznP[data-expand=after]{-webkit-padding-after:128px;padding-block-end:128px}.ParallaxSection_container__3YznP[data-expand=both]{padding-block:128px}.ParallaxSection_background__nPEH_{position:absolute;top:100%;left:0;width:100vw;height:calc(100% + 75vh);transform:translateY(-100%);pointer-events:none;filter:brightness(.5) saturate(1.25)}.ParallaxSection_background__nPEH_ img{width:100%;height:100%;object-fit:cover;object-position:center}